About the role
The Clinic Care Assistant participates in the care of patients in a clinic setting by:
- Measuring and recording vital signs
- Placing patients in rooms
- Preparing patients and families for exams/procedures
- Providing patient/family support
- Auxiliarying the nursing staff and healthcare providers during exams and procedures
- Maintaining appropriate visit notes, test, and x-ray results
- Performing clinic-specific technical skills
- Maintaining the clinic environment including supplies and equipment
- May be required to float to other ACU clinics as needed for staffing
Qualifications
- High school diploma or equivalent required
- State of Florida CNA Certification required
- May substitute one of the following for CNA Certification:
- Nursing student currently enrolled in an approved program for preparation of professional nurses
- Nursing student currently enrolled in an approved program for preparation of Licensed Practical Nurses
- Basic Life Support (CPR) is required (or must be obtained within first month of employment)
- Initiative, multitasking ability, and responsibility-taking are essential
- Proven problem-solving and teamwork skills are essential
- Understanding of medical terminology is preferred
- Successful completion of practice-specific training requirements and demonstration of practice-specific competencies
- No motor vehicle operator designation provided
- Licensure/Certification/Registration: Must possess and maintain current certification or registration as a CNA. Basic Life Support (CPR) is required (or obtained within 1st month of employment). Must maintain current Basic Life Support (CPR).
